Join Us for a Conversation on Climate Change and Snowsports
Date: Monday, February 24
Time: 6:30 - 7:30 PM Pacific Time
Where: Virtual Meeting
Climate change has been described by the National Ski Areas Association (NSAA) as an existential threat to snowsports. Rising temperatures, shifting snowfall patterns, and shortened seasons are already affecting ski areas and the future of the sports we love.
The Far West Ski Association (FWSA) Environment Committee invites you to an important virtual meeting to discuss these challenges and how the ski industry is responding to them. This is an opportunity to learn from leaders who are actively working to ensure a sustainable future for skiing and snowboarding.
